Midea JSG40-24PCH-LP vs Ruud RUTGH-CSR11I
The Ruud RUTGH-CSR11I is the more efficient unit: UEF 0.96 versus 0.95 — about 1% less energy for the same hot water. At national average rates that works out to about $255/year for the Ruud RUTGH-CSR11I against $522/year for the Midea JSG40-24PCH-LP — a $267 annual difference. The Ruud RUTGH-CSR11I sustains the higher flow (5.8 GPM vs 4.4 GPM under the DOE test).
